User-Agent: Mutt/1.5.11+cvs20060126 Sender: linux-kernel-owner@vger.kernel.org X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org The following patch adds the RTC class driver for the Samsung S3C24XX class of SoCs. It is update from drivers/char/s3c2410-rtc.c (which this patch does not remove). There are two issues that I would like to resolve before finally submitting this patch: 1) The calling of rtc_update_irq(), should the count be initialised to 1 when the periodic interrupt is started 2) The original dirver is s3c2410-rtc, abut the new one is now named rtc-s3c24xx to fit in with the new drivers. This will mean tha the name of the module produced will change. Is it ok to keep the s3c2410-rtc name, or will the rename be preferred? --- linux-2.6.17/drivers/rtc/Kconfig 2006-06-18 02:49:35.000000000 +0100 +++ linux-2.6.17-rc5-rtc1/drivers/rtc/Kconfig 2006-06-19 11:39:44.000000000 +0100 @@ -117,6 +117,18 @@ config RTC_DRV_RS5C372 This driver can also be built as a module.
